Average cattle farmer salary by education level

Cattle farmers with a Master's degree earn more than those without, at $58,108 annually. With a Bachelor's degree, cattle farmers earn a median annual income of $53,156 compared to $48,476 for cattle farmers with an Associate degree.
Cattle farmer education levelCattle farmer salary
Master's Degree$58,108
High School Diploma or Less$45,374
Bachelor's Degree$53,156
Some College/ Associate Degree$48,476
